Nestlé Waters North America has signed an agreement with recycled PET plastic (rPET) supplier CarbonLITE, which will expand its U.S. operations by building a third facility in Pennsylvania.
Charter NEX Films has opened a new facility in Blythewood, S.C., which will house state-of-the-art production technologies to manufacture blown films for food, medical and protective packaging.

Honeywell is collaborating with Fetch Robotics to provide distribution centers with autonomous mobile robots to help them more effectively fulfill growing e-commerce orders.
Mars, the global food conglomerate behind pet food brands such as Whiskas, Cesar and Pedigree, has just announced a new partnership with Terracycle to enable pet food packaging to be recycled.
A new study of the sleeve labeling market has just been published by AWA Alexander Watson Associates. The report confirms how strongly sleeve labeling technology has established itself in a relatively short timescale, claiming around 18 percent of the overall global label market.
With its recent acquisition of a significant share in Canada-based Smart Skin Technologies, German glass packaging manufacturer Schott aims to leverage drone technology to raise packaging quality and reduce breakage on filling lines.
